Apprenticeship Programs In Automotive Mechanics

Apprenticeship programs in automotive mechanics offer aspiring mechanics the opportunity to learn and gain hands-on experience in the field through a combination of classroom instruction and on-the-job training.

Key Features

  • Hands-on training
  • Mentorship from experienced mechanics
  • Classroom instruction
  • Opportunities for certification
  • Job placement assistance

Pros

  • Hands-on learning experience
  • Potential for job placement
  • Ability to earn while you learn

Cons

  • May require a significant time commitment
  • Potentially lower pay during apprenticeship period
